summaryrefslogtreecommitdiff
path: root/libpod/network/network.go
diff options
context:
space:
mode:
authorOpenShift Merge Robot <openshift-merge-robot@users.noreply.github.com>2021-02-02 05:53:15 -0500
committerGitHub <noreply@github.com>2021-02-02 05:53:15 -0500
commit2314af70bdacf75135a11b48b87dba8e461a43ea (patch)
treeb5083d04cb87739a1ff38295fc1fa0b4fadc90e3 /libpod/network/network.go
parent52575db9b40ad141dc5521d7646e8ed636651b54 (diff)
parente11d8f15e8d7559bc70ebef2dd0125be9d692da5 (diff)
downloadpodman-2314af70bdacf75135a11b48b87dba8e461a43ea.tar.gz
podman-2314af70bdacf75135a11b48b87dba8e461a43ea.tar.bz2
podman-2314af70bdacf75135a11b48b87dba8e461a43ea.zip
Merge pull request #9189 from baude/macvlandriver
add macvlan as a supported network driver
Diffstat (limited to 'libpod/network/network.go')
-rw-r--r--libpod/network/network.go12
1 files changed, 9 insertions, 3 deletions
diff --git a/libpod/network/network.go b/libpod/network/network.go
index 0fb878b18..0ff14c1f7 100644
--- a/libpod/network/network.go
+++ b/libpod/network/network.go
@@ -17,11 +17,17 @@ import (
"github.com/sirupsen/logrus"
)
-// DefaultNetworkDriver is the default network type used
-var DefaultNetworkDriver = "bridge"
+var (
+ // BridgeNetworkDriver defines the bridge cni driver
+ BridgeNetworkDriver = "bridge"
+ // DefaultNetworkDriver is the default network type used
+ DefaultNetworkDriver = BridgeNetworkDriver
+ // MacVLANNetworkDriver defines the macvlan cni driver
+ MacVLANNetworkDriver = "macvlan"
+)
// SupportedNetworkDrivers describes the list of supported drivers
-var SupportedNetworkDrivers = []string{DefaultNetworkDriver}
+var SupportedNetworkDrivers = []string{BridgeNetworkDriver, MacVLANNetworkDriver}
// isSupportedDriver checks if the user provided driver is supported
func isSupportedDriver(driver string) error {